Sheds Into Garages: The Essential Features
You should consider your garage as more than a vehicle barn; a real handyman makes the most out of available space, and if you consider every inch of your property valuable commodity, then you’ll likely consider your garage as a hobbyist’s haven as well. Few people fault you for tinkering with your vehicles whenever you’re able to, and for some this means spending the wee hours of the morning changing oil or cleaning the engine. You’ll have fewer problems if your garage was actually part of your property; you should consider a portable setup if you’re in dire need of extra shelter or a car cover just won’t do for your new luxury ride. A portable garage still deserves the essential amenities and then some, though.
Set Up aPower Source for Your Car Shed
You’ll have to set up an electrical line for your portable garage. It’s easier than you think, since you won’t have to worry about installing the lines behind paneling or running these underground. You only need to invest in the length of wire, some PVC or plastic tubing, and plenty of outlets for all your electrical equipment and accessories. Hire ...
... an electrician to do the layout if you can’t figure out the connections. You can’t have too many outlets in your portable garage, so make sure there’s at least one located on every corner or wall, for convenience and accessibility.
Peak and Maintain the Comforts
Install a ceiling fan in the middle of the garage to maintain comfortable temperatures. The fan should keep warm air circulating during the autumn and winter chill, cool air during the summer. Make sure there’s ample light for your workspace. Set up fluorescent lights above your workbench and your vehicles so you can work with ease and in comfort. Remember that proper lighting increases your efficiency, cutting your work in half and leaving more time for important stuff, like fixing the kitchen cupboards or patching the leaking roof.
All the Essential Tools and then Some
Your workspace should have all the essential tools and equipment. A vise grip is the staple tool for grease monkeys; opt for the largest jaws available if you want enough space to clamp everything in your shed. Make room for a sizable, waterproof, metal cabinet, and store all your tools and flammables. Your storage should be within reach so you don’t have to hustle around looking for the right wrench or the fire extinguisher. An extinguisher is essential, and it’s better if you have a couple to spare and place on both ends of your garage. Opt for ten-pound extinguishers, reserved for dire emergencies, but keep buckets of sand and water for minor accidents.
Safety as Priority, not an Afterthought
Safety should be your first priority, especially when you’re housing flammables in the same shed where you keep your vehicles. Install an exhaust fan along the walls to maintain safe, breathable environment. Goggles, gloves, and boots are also necessary if you want to work in comfort and safety. If you’re tasks involve welding and drilling, a dual-cartridge mask ensures you’ll be around long enough to see your restoration or custom work completed.
